Hydrogen Bond
A weak bond between two molecules resulting from an electrostatic attraction between a proton in one molecule and an electronegative atom in the other.
Polar Covalent Bond
A polar covalent bond is a type of chemical bond where electrons are unequally shared between atoms, leading to a distribution of electrical charge.
Water Molecule
A molecule consisting of two hydrogen atoms and one oxygen atom, chemically represented as H2O.
Salt Crystal
A type of crystal formed by the evaporation of a solution containing salt, commonly NaCl (table salt).
